Sagarejo (Georgian: Script error: No such module "Lang".) is a town in Kakheti, Georgia. It is situated Script error: No such module "convert". east of Georgia's capital, Tbilisi, and has the population of 10,359 (2023 census).[1] It serves as an administrative center of Sagarejo district.

The town is traditionally considered a chief settlement of the Gare-Kakheti area (Outer Kakheti).Script error: No such module "Unsubst". The settlement is first mentioned in written records in the 11th century under the name of Tvali, literally meaning "an eye".Script error: No such module "Unsubst". Later, it came to be known as Sagarejo, i.e., "of Gareja", indicating that the area was owned by the David Gareja monastery.Script error: No such module "Unsubst". It acquired town status in 1962.Script error: No such module "Unsubst".

The fortified ruins of the ancient Ninotsminda Cathedral are located near Sagarejo.Script error: No such module "Unsubst".
